With Hacks at a Record High, Crypto Needs to Find Better Ways to Keep Users Safe

The figures are in: October was the busiest month for crypto protocol exploits this year, with some $760 million stolen. The cumulative total for crypto hacks in 2022 is now at least $2.98 billion, already more than double the amount stolen through exploits in 2021, according to blockchain security firm Peckshield. A Huge Glut of Bitcoin Mining Rigs Is Sitting Unused in Boxes

Hundreds of thousands of brand new mining rigs that could be generating bitcoin (BTC) have never been used, further skewing the economics of cryptocurrency mining, a sector that has been hit hard by sinking prices for bitcoin and other tokens and by high energy costs.
